Biotechnology can be defined as the usage and manipulation of living organisms such as microorganisms in other to manufacture products that are essential for every day living.

Areas where biotechnology can be applied is

a. Industrial usage: The use of microorganisms such as yeast and other beneficial microorganisms to create foods such as Wine, Cheese, Yoghurt, Beer.

b. Medical and pharmaceutical usage: The use of microorganisms to create drugs that are required for treatment of diseases.

An effective strategy that is used in biotechnology to solve a problem are

Genetic engineering: This is a strategy in biotechnology whereby the genetic material or Genes( DNA) of living organisms such as plants and animals are genetic modified or altered to produce a better and improved version of the plant or animal.

In this present times, plants have been genetic modified to produce crops of a different colour or shapes with an improved nutritional composition.

What nerve branches feed into the nerve plexuses?
S_A_V [24]

Answer:

Nerve plexuses are composed of afferent and efferent fibers that arise from the merging of the anterior rami of spinal nerves and blood vessels. There are five spinal nerve plexuses—except in the thoracic region—as well as other forms of autonomic plexuses, many of which are a part of the enteric nervous system. A plexus is a bundle of intersecting nerves, blood vessels, or lymphatic vessels in the human body. These bundles typically originate from the same anatomical area and serve specific areas of the body. Bundles of nerves that form a plexus communicate information to your brain about pain, temperature, and pressure.
